demagnetize

verb
/diːˈmæɡnɪtaɪz/

Meaning

To remove or reduce the magnetic properties of something.

Example Sentences

The technician demagnetized the old cassette tape.

Synonyms

neutralize, deactivate, discharge, erase

Antonyms

magnetize, charge

Collocations

demagnetize tape, demagnetize card, demagnetize device
